Is fruiting possible on wheat berries alone?

So far I worked mostly with wheat berries, and noticed that they don't fruit not even invitro if left in a lit place with invitro pinning coir cakes neighbouring them.

No pins on a tray, without a casing layer, some fruits with a casing, and good flushes with mixed in substrates (not bulk subs, I don't go below 30%spawn-70%bulk ratio)

Water content is on the lower side 50-60% but is that the only cause?

Depends on how you define 'well', I suppose.
Multispore LC to WBS, cased with MGMC.
Four and a half flushes from that tub.



Granted, spawning to a bulk sub like poo or coir is going to give bigger, prettier flushes. But in terms of space, time and money involved, fruiting from grains is a viable option.
